About

Byeong‐Su Kim is a scholar working on Materials Chemistry, Organic Chemistry and Electrical and Electronic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Byeong‐Su Kim has authored 221 papers receiving a total of 10.7k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 78 papers in Materials Chemistry, 61 papers in Organic Chemistry and 58 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ering. Recurrent topics in Byeong‐Su Kim’s work include Advanced Polymer Synthesis and Characterization (35 papers), Graphene research and applications (27 papers) and Conducting polymers and applications (27 papers). Byeong‐Su Kim is often cited by papers focused on Advanced Polymer Synthesis and Characterization (35 papers), Graphene research and applications (27 papers) and Conducting polymers and applications (27 papers). Byeong‐Su Kim collaborates with scholars based in South Korea, United States and Japan. Byeong‐Su Kim's co-authors include Paula T. Hammond, Taemin Lee, Minsu Gu, Yuri Choi, T. Andrew Taton, Eeseul Shin, Sang Wook Park, Eunyong Seo, Seung Woo Lee and Yang Shao‐Horn and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of the American Chemical Society, Angewandte Chemie International Edition and Advanced Materials.
